In 2017 Universal Music Japan implemented Kaonavi Talent Management to centralize Talent Management functions within its HR organization in Tokyo. The deployment was positioned as a localized talent and appraisal platform to support global and local HR planning, with explicit linkage to reporting flows to headquarters in the United States and the parent company in France. The Kaonavi Talent Management implementation included configuration of core talent modules and a rebuilt appraisal workflow, the transfer of legacy appraisal records into Kaonavi, and creation of operation manuals and localization settings. The project scope covered talent profiles, appraisal scoring, and support for global aptitude test workflows that were localized in 2018 and 2020, reflecting continuous configuration and change management activities. Operationally Kaonavi Talent Management was instrumented with data transfer automation to the organization s Core HCM and to a global data warehouse, enabling automated feeds from the Japanese HR system into global reporting. The HR technology landscape was coordinated with concurrent Workday HCM initiatives and SAP reporting automation, and the team integrated Kaonavi outputs into broader payroll BPO reporting and global headcount forecasting processes. Governance and rollout emphasized process documentation, manual creation, and workflow systematization, with the HR team centralizing inquiry handling via a kintone based Digital HR Service Desk and aligning appraisal operations to standardized procedures. The Kaonavi Talent Management deployment supported broader HR process transformation activities at Universal Music Japan, while separate payroll reporting automation to SAP delivered an explicitly stated 57 percent reduction in compensation and benefits working hours as part of the payroll BPO program.

Universal Music Japan is a Media organization based in Japan, with around 550 employees and annual revenues of $100.0 million.
Universal Music Japan operates a diverse technology stack with applications such as Kaonavi Talent Management, ResNexus Booking and Coveo Qubit CommerceAI, covering areas like Talent Management, Reservation and Booking Management and Personalization and Product Recommendations.
Universal Music Japan has invested in cloud applications and AI-driven platforms to optimize efficiency and growth, collaborating with vendors such as Kaonavi, ResNexus and Coveo.
Universal Music Japan recently adopted applications including ResNexus Booking in 2024, Criteo Commerce Media Platform in 2023 and Coveo Qubit CommerceAI in 2022, highlighting its ongoing modernization strategy.
